#4e0b6e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e0b6e is composed of 30.6% red, 4.3%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.1% cyan, 90%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 280.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 23.7%. #4e0b6e color hex could be obtained by blending #9c16dc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

● #4e0b6e color description : Very dark violet.
#4e0b6e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e0b6e has RGB values of R:78, G:11,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 5114734.

Shades and Tints of #4e0b6e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f9f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e0b6e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3a3f is the less saturated color, while #510277 is the most saturated one.
